Review of 2017 Harley-Davidson CVO Street Glide
The 2017 Harley-Davidson CVO Street Glide stands out as a premium model in the touring motorcycle segment, delivering a combination of style, comfort, and advanced technology that appeals to both seasoned riders and newcomers alike. With its powerful Milwaukee-Eight 117 engine, it offers thrilling performance while maintaining the iconic Harley-Davidson rumble that enthusiasts cherish. The bike's sleek design, highlighted by custom paint schemes and chrome accents, ensures that it not only rides well but also turns heads on the road. Features such as the Boom! Box GTS infotainment system, full LED lighting, and a plush seat enhance the overall riding experience, making long journeys more enjoyable. Beyond its aesthetic and technical prowess, the CVO Street Glide represents significant value for those seeking a high-end touring motorcycle. The attention to detail in its craftsmanship and the inclusion of premium features justify its price point, making it a worthy investment for riders who prioritize quality and performance. With a blend of comfort, power, and cutting-edge technology, the 2017 CVO Street Glide is more than just a motorcycle; it's an experience that embodies the spirit of freedom and adventure that defines the Harley-Davidson brand. For those ready to embrace the open road with style, this model is undoubtedly a compelling choice.
Advantages
- Powerful Performance: The CVO Street Glide is equipped with a robust 117 cubic inch Milwaukee-Eight engine, delivering impressive torque and acceleration, making it great for both cruising and highway riding.
- Premium Features: This model comes loaded with high-end features such as a premium sound system, a touchscreen infotainment system, and advanced audio options, providing an exceptional riding experience.
- Distinctive Styling: With its custom paint options, sleek lines, and unique CVO badging, the Street Glide stands out with a striking appearance that appeals to those who appreciate a classic yet modern aesthetic.
- Comfort and Ergonomics: Designed for long-distance rides, the CVO Street Glide offers comfortable seating, ergonomic controls, and ample storage space, making it ideal for touring enthusiasts.
- Customization Options: As part of the CVO lineup, this motorcycle allows for extensive customization, allowing riders to personalize their bike to fit their style and preferences, enhancing the overall ownership experience.
Disadvantages
- High Price Point: The CVO Street Glide is one of the premium models in Harley's lineup, which means it comes with a hefty price tag that may not be accessible or justifiable for all buyers.
- Weight: Weighing in at over 800 pounds, the CVO Street Glide can feel cumbersome, especially for new riders or those who prefer a lighter motorcycle for easier handling and maneuverability.
- Limited Cornering Clearance: The design of the bike prioritizes comfort and style, which can lead to reduced cornering clearance and may limit performance on twisty roads compared to sportier motorcycles.
- Fuel Economy: While the powerful engine delivers performance, it can also result in lower fuel efficiency compared to smaller touring bikes or cruisers, leading to more frequent stops at the pump on long rides.
- Customization Limitations: Although the CVO models are highly customizable, some proprietary parts and features may limit aftermarket options, making it more challenging for owners seeking extensive personalization.
Alternatives
- Indian Roadmaster The Indian Roadmaster is a premium touring motorcycle that combines classic styling with modern technology. Featuring a powerful Thunder Stroke 111 engine, it offers exceptional comfort with a plush seat, ample storage, and advanced infotainment options. The Roadmaster is designed for long-distance cruising with features like heated grips, a fairing-mounted windscreen, and a spacious saddlebag setup.
- Honda Gold Wing Renowned for its luxurious ride and advanced features, the Honda Gold Wing is a top choice for touring enthusiasts. Powered by a smooth, horizontally opposed six-cylinder engine, it boasts a sophisticated ride-by-wire throttle system, adjustable suspension, and cutting-edge technology like a premium audio system and navigation. The Gold Wing is designed for comfort, with a relaxed seating position and generous storage capacity.
- Yamaha Star Eluder The Yamaha Star Eluder is a stylish bagger that offers a blend of performance and comfort. With a powerful 113-cubic-inch V-twin engine, it provides a strong and responsive ride. The Eluder features a sleek design, comfortable seating, and a full fairing for wind protection. Its infotainment system includes Bluetooth connectivity, making it a great option for tech-savvy riders who enjoy long rides.
- BMW K 1600 B The BMW K 1600 B is a sport-touring bike that combines performance with luxury. It features a powerful inline-six engine that delivers smooth power and torque. The K 1600 B is known for its agile handling, comfortable seating, and advanced electronics, including adaptive cruise control and a premium audio system. Its distinctive bagger design and high-quality finishes make it a standout choice for touring enthusiasts.
- Kawasaki Vulcan 1700 Vaquero The Kawasaki Vulcan 1700 Vaquero is a stylish and powerful bagger ideal for long-distance rides. Equipped with a 1700cc V-twin engine, it offers strong performance and a comfortable riding position. The Vaquero features a full fairing, hard saddlebags, and a modern infotainment system with Bluetooth connectivity. Its aggressive styling and smooth ride make it a worthy alternative for riders seeking a blend of style and functionality. These alternatives provide a range of features and styles that cater to touring enthusiasts looking for options beyond the Harley-Davidson CVO Street Glide.
